POP MUSIC

1. Finish off this Ronan Keating line, "You say it best......."

2. Mick Hucknall is the lead singer of which group?

3. Hearsay, winners of Popstars in 2001, launched which single on the unsuspecting British Public?

4. In 2003, the group Fountains of Wayne were in love with Stacy's what?

5. Howard Donald is a member of which recently reformed boy band?

6. Who sang the song 'Don't Speak' in the 90's?

7. Which Irish band topped the first official download chart in the UK in 2004?

8. Bjork, the slightly peculiar songstress is fro which country?

9. Which band had the best selling album of last year? Was it:

a)Eyes Open by Snow Patrol b)Ta-Da by Scissor Sisters c)Whatever People Say I Am, That's What I'm Not by the Arctic Monkeys

10. The last Christmas number one in 2006 was called A Moment Like This? Who sang it?


Answers to Pop Music (I said no peeking)

1. When you say nothing at all     2. Simply Red      3. Pure and Simple      4.  Mom     5. Take That      6.No Doubt     7. Westlife     8.  Iceland     9. A)   10. Leona Lewis
